Bill Belichick Postgame Press Conference - 11/7/2010

Patriots head coach Bill Belichick addresses the media during his postgame press conference on Sunday, November 7, 2010.

(Opening Statement)
"I'll start off by giving Cleveland a lot of credit. They did a great job today, they obviously did everything better than we did, every single thing you could measure. They were clearly the better team. They deserved to win and had an outstanding performance. We didn't do the things we need to do to win, to really be competitive, and that was the result of the game. Obviously, we have a lot of work to do. We're a better team than we showed today but we weren't today. Certainly hats off to them, they did a good job. Clearly the better team."

(On the two Patriot fumbles)
"We didn't take care of the ball."

(On frustration over turnovers)
"We didn't do a good job on anything today. Pick any subject you want and say 'How did it go?' and it wasn't very good."

(On whether the loss was more a lack of preparation or execution)
"They just did everything better than we did today. I'm sure there are a lot of factors involved."

(On what phase of the game played the most important factor in the loss)
"Like I said, they did a good job, they played well. They played well across the board."

(On the status of K Stephen Gostkowski's injury)
"His leg tightened up in the game; obviously he wasn't able to finish and kick. So, we'll have to see. But he wasn't able to finish the game."

(On if Browns RB Peyton Hillis surprised the Patriots)
"No, he's a good player, runs hard. We've seen him do that."

(On the difficulty of the offense getting in a rhythm)
"We didn't have anything today in any phase of the game. I wouldn't single out anything or anybody. It was just a total victory by Cleveland in all phases of the game, everything you can measure."

(On if the Patriots had seen anything like the touchdown run by Browns WR Chansi Stuckey)
"No, it was a new play, they hadn't run it this year. We had prepared for plays like that, but we obviously didn't prepare very well. It was a good play by them, not a good play by us, that's all it is."

(On if the Patriots expected the Browns to be as physical as they were)
"We've seen them (Cleveland) play all year, that's the way they play."

(On message to the team after the game)
"We've just got a lot of work to do."

(On why there were a lot of missed passes)
"They (Cleveland) did a good job. They did a better job than we did."

(On what he said to Browns Head Coach Eric Mangini during the postgame handshake)
"I congratulated him."
